Handling and storage
7
Handling: Keep container closed (treat as an alkaline material). Do not ingest. Do not get in eyes, on skin, or on clothing.
Provide sufficient ventilation and avoid prolonged skin contact. Wash hands thoroughly after handling.
Precautions for safe handling
Storage: Do not store in metallic containers or near acids. Keep out of reach of children. The product should be stored in
the original containers in a cool and dry location. Keep container closed and away from heat and flame sources. Since
emptied containers retain product residues, all hazard precautions given in this MSDS must be observed. Protect from
heat.

Eyewash Stations; Ventilation Systems; Showers
Appropriate engineering controls
Eyes: Use proper protection such as safety goggles or a face-shield.
Skin: Wear resistant gloves. To prevent repeated or prolonged skin contact wear
impervious clothing and boots during handling of spills.
Inhalation: Respirator is advised in the absence of proper ventilation.
Clothing: Impervious coverall or any protective suit is recommended.
